Ghostbusters fans check out this video

dionysus11

MSTmike3K
Feb 28, 2008
561
2
18
Columbus GA
if you are a fan of ghostbusters,or of angry videogame nerd then this video will make you very happy. It's a ghostbusters location tour in New York,they go to all the sites from the movie and match up the scenes with the movie today, it's a really great video.

 
Last edited by a moderator: